5 a.m. Free agency will officially open at noon with the start of the league’s “legal tampering period,” when teams are permitted to negotiate with free agents.
The Patriots are interested in the best free-agent receiver available, Alec Pierce, with A.J. Brown trade talks reportedly at a standstill. Expect the Pats to also dive into the edge defender market, where their best free agent, K’Lavon Chaisson, could leave for a major deal. Veteran safety Jaylinn Hawkins, defensive tackle Khyiris Tonga and tight end Austin Hooper are the other top internal free agents to know.
